Immigrants from Japan vs Immigrants from Lithuania Median Family Income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 339,915,551 people shows no corre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Japan and median family income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.048 and weighted average of $122,764.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 117,713,415 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Lithuania and median family income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.680 and weighted average of $118,053, a difference of 4.0%.
